aboutsummaryrefslogtreecommitdiff
path: root/server/area_manager.py
diff options
context:
space:
mode:
authorCerapter <cerap@protonmail.com>2018-08-27 16:09:11 +0200
committerCerapter <cerap@protonmail.com>2018-08-27 16:09:11 +0200
commit7aac266b9bf0eb622e23c84306dbe095ef99871c (patch)
tree0cdb417a483df66b15d9c518eec579eb68a0fa42 /server/area_manager.py
parent0fb3b7edbfdc712710347aba05ce51316660a891 (diff)
Additional jukebox check just in case someone is alone, but is choosing different songs.
Diffstat (limited to 'server/area_manager.py')
-rw-r--r--server/area_manager.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/server/area_manager.py b/server/area_manager.py
index 07c60730..e1b7e552 100644
--- a/server/area_manager.py
+++ b/server/area_manager.py
@@ -168,7 +168,7 @@ class AreaManager:
self.current_music = ''
return
- if vote_picked.char_id != self.jukebox_prev_char_id or len(self.jukebox_votes) > 1:
+ if vote_picked.char_id != self.jukebox_prev_char_id or vote_picked.name != self.current_music or len(self.jukebox_votes) > 1:
self.jukebox_prev_char_id = vote_picked.char_id
if vote_picked.showname == '':
self.send_command('MC', vote_picked.name, vote_picked.client.char_id)